Australia's Dominant Performance: Women's T20 Cricket World Cup Highlights (2026)

Australia's women's cricket team dominated South Africa in a thrilling T20 World Cup encounter, securing a 65-run victory. The match was a display of Australia's prowess in spin bowling and aggressive batting, leaving South Africa struggling to keep up. With a net-run-rate advantage, Australia's captain, Sophie Molineux, led her team to a formidable total of 172-8, setting a challenging target for South Africa.

South Africa's innings got off to a rocky start, with Sune Luus dropping a sitter and the team losing wickets regularly. The turning point came when Georgia Wareham, the Australian bowler, claimed a crucial run-out, reducing South Africa to 81-3. From there, Australia's spinners took control, with Wareham finishing with three wickets for 13 runs.

The match highlighted Australia's strength in spin bowling, with Wareham and Molineux delivering tight overs and claiming wickets. In contrast, South Africa's batting struggled, with the team losing seven wickets for 26 runs in just over five overs. Laura Wolvaardt, the South African captain, faced challenges against the Australian spin, managing only 37 runs from her 38 balls.

Despite the loss, South Africa's Marizanne Kapp and Ayabonga Khaka showed resilience, with Kapp finishing with 1-28 and Khaka taking a crucial wicket. However, the overall performance fell short, and Australia's victory was a testament to their strategic bowling and disciplined fielding.

The match had a significant impact on the tournament's standings, with Australia's net-run-rate advantage proving crucial. As the tournament progresses, Australia's dominance in spin bowling and their ability to adapt to different conditions will be key to their success. South Africa, on the other hand, will need to find solutions to their batting struggles and improve their net-run-rate if they are to remain in contention for a semi-final spot.
